SQL (7)

Busquedas con Full-text y MySQL (WebTaller)

Fuente: WebTaller

Tutorial de administración, gestión y utilización de MySQL (MundoGeek)

Fuente: Mundogeek.net
 
MySQL es uno de los sistemas de gestión de bases de datos más populares del mercado. Se trata de un SGBD basado en el modelo relacional, con licencia dual GPL y propietaria, desarrollado por MySQL AB, una compañía propiedad de Sun Microsystems, creadores de Java, desde Enero de 2008.

Buscador con PHP

Un Buscador Simple

phpEn este artículo veremos como crear un buscador con PHP y MySQL que servirá para cualquier tabla MySQL de nuestra base de datos y que podrá ser mostrado facilmente en nuestro sitio web.

El script consta de tres partes. La configuración, el formulario y el proceso del formulario. La primera parte, la más sencilla de todas, es donde tendrás que poner los datos de tu base de datos y la tabla donde quieres que el buscador realice las búsquedas. No tiene pérdida. Al final de la configuración realizamos la conexión a la base de datos ya que la usaremos cada vez que se acceda al buscador.

En la segunda parte se trata la creación del formulario. Como no conocemos los campos de la tabla tenemos que generar ese camop del formulario dinámicamente. Para ello utilizamos la sentencia "SHOW FIELDS FROM table" que nos devuelve información de todos los campos que hay en la tabla. De esta forma conseguimos que nos liste todos los campos de la tabla que hayamos escogido al configurar, en el formulario.

PHP Mini Admin para MySQL

phpminiadmin es una alternativa muy ligera y reducida de phpMyAdmin, en vez de instalar unos 10 megas solo sería cerca de 10k.

phpminiadmin.png

Carrito de la compra (PHP/MySQL)

Código:

<?
/* shoppingcart.php
*
*
*/

if(!$session && !$scid) {
$session = md5(uniqid(rand()));
SetCookie("scid", "$session", time() + 14400);
} /* last number is expiration time in seconds, 14400 sec = 4 hrs */

class Cart {
function check_item($table, $session, $product) {
$query = "SELECT * FROM $table WHERE session='$session' AND product='$product' ";
$result = mysql_query($query);

if(!$result) {
return 0;
}

Instalación de un servidor MySQL

- Desde la Web oficial www.mysql.org podemos descargar gratuitamente la última versión de MySQL. Encontraremos diferentes versiones según el sistema operativo al que queramos instalar-lo.

 

- Una vez instalado podemos configurar el MySQL. El puerto, el host y el socket són parámetros importantes a tener en cuenta ya que son los que suelen dar más problemas. Se pueden configurar desde el archivo my.cnf, que se encuentra en la carpeta “mysql/bin/”.

- En la Web oficial www.phpmyadmin.net encontraremos un gestor de bases de datos muy utilizado actualmente y gratuito. (descarga)

Buscador con PHP

Muchas páginas llevan su buscador propio de elementos dentro de la Web. Con este código se puede hacer un buscador sencillo que busca una palabra dentro de una Tabla con muchas noticias y cuando la encuentra la muestra por pantalla.

La palabra o texto a buscar se lo enviamos desde otra página usando una variable que llamaremos $palabra.

<FORM ACTION="busca.php><INPUT TYPE="TEXT" NAME="palabra"><INPUT TYPE="SUBMIT" NAME="Buscar">"

Busca.php

<?php
$conexio = mysql_connect("nombre_servidor", "usuario", "contraseña");
mysql_select_db ("nombre_BBDD", $conexio) OR die ("No se puede conectar");

Distribuir contenido (C01 _th3me_)